Resizing a signature for online forms
Online forms, especially exam and government applications, often ask for your signature as an image at an exact pixel size, and sometimes within a file-size limit as well. Scan or photograph your signature and it is almost never the size the form wants. This page resizes it to the exact pixels you need. Upload your signature image, set the width and height (or pick a common size), and download it. Fit mode keeps the whole signature inside the frame without cropping any of it, so none of the strokes are cut off. It all runs in your browser, so your signature is never uploaded. A signature upload usually has two requirements: the pixel size and, often, a maximum file size in KB. This page handles the pixel size. If your form also caps the file size, resize here and then compress the result, which lowers the KB without changing the dimensions. If your scan has a lot of white space around the signature, crop it tight first so it fills the frame.
